Score 95/100 · Drink 2022-2048, Neal Martin, Nov 2018

The 2015 Gevrey-Chambertin Les Cazetiers 1er Cru clearly has the most sensual bouquet among the sextet of Les Cazetiers in this flight, possessing copious red cherry, crushed strawberry, vanilla pod and light flinty scents, perhaps with a judicious amount of stem addition. The harmonious, exquisitely detailed palate is very well balanced with a crisp line of acidity, the red fruit merging with more black toward a sustained finish of palpable mineralité . This is a very sophisticated Les Cazetiers destined for long-term aging. Tasted blind at the annual Burgfest tasting.

Score 91/100 · Drink 2023-2032, Stephen Tanzer, Vinous, Jan 2018

Medium red. Very ripe but reticent scents of roasted red fruits, plum and damp earth. Fresher in the mouth than on the nose, conveying more energy than the Clos du Fonteny, with its medicinal cherry, wild berry and spice flavors complemented by a chocolatey nuance. Nicely balanced and not at all lacking in spine. Here, too, there's a firming touch of minerality. This wine will need several years in the cellar to unwind.
